2013 Ford Focus problems & reliability
2,105 owner complaints filed with NHTSA for the 2013 Ford Focus, alongside 11 safety recall campaigns. Last verified Aug 7, 2026. Complaints are unverified reports submitted by owners to the federal Office of Defects Investigation.
Each complaint is counted once (by NHTSA case number), even when it names several vehicles.
24 complaints report injuries (28 injured, 3 deaths reported).
Federal crash records (FARS 2020–2023): 2013 Ford Focus vehicles were involved in 129 fatal crashes with 75 occupant deaths. Involvement counts are not adjusted for how many are on the road and do not imply fault or a vehicle defect.
Most reported problems
| Component | Complaints | Share |
|---|---|---|
| Power Train | 1,098 | 52% |
| Engine | 343 | 16% |
| Electrical System | 273 | 13% |
| Steering | 273 | 13% |
| Fuel/propulsion System | 208 | 10% |
| Unknown OR Other | 195 | 9% |
| Vehicle Speed Control | 111 | 5% |
| Structure | 83 | 4% |
| Fuel System, Gasoline | 53 | 3% |
| Latches/locks/linkages | 53 | 3% |
Component groups as classified by NHTSA. A complaint can name more than one component, so shares may sum to more than 100%.

Mileage when problems occurred
Half of the failures with a reported odometer reading occurred by 56,000 miles (middle 50% between 24,000 and 88,000 miles), based on 1,594 complaints that included mileage.

TSBs are repair guidance manufacturers send to dealers — they are not recalls and repairs are not automatically free. Full documents are available on NHTSA’s site.
